Автор Тема: Отображаются отключенные элементы  (Прочитано 6361 раз)

Pereiro

  • Гость
Отображаются отключенные элементы
« : Ноября 11, 2011, 04:34:43 pm »
в 5.0 Категория отключена, но отображается в каталоге, при нажатии получаешь 404

nictboom

  • Гость
Re: Отображаются отключенные элементы
« Ответ #1 : Ноября 11, 2011, 07:06:14 pm »
в cfg/category_functions.php:
	
$q db_query("select categoryID, name, products_count, products_count_admin, parent, enabled, hurl from ".CATEGORIES_TABLE.' where parent='.$path[$level].' ORDER BY '.CONF_SORT_CATEGORY." ".CONF_SORT_CATEGORY_BY);
заменить на
	
$q db_query("select categoryID, name, products_count, products_count_admin, parent, enabled, hurl from ".CATEGORIES_TABLE.' where enabled=1 and parent='.$path[$level].' ORDER BY '.CONF_SORT_CATEGORY." ".CONF_SORT_CATEGORY_BY);


Оффлайн Юрий

  • Старожил
  • ****
  • Сообщений: 322
    • Просмотр профиля
    • Во-Сток
Re: Отображаются отключенные элементы
« Ответ #2 : Ноября 12, 2011, 10:29:46 pm »
всеравно не работает

nictboom

  • Гость
Re: Отображаются отключенные элементы
« Ответ #3 : Ноября 13, 2011, 01:04:32 am »
смотря что и где.

Оффлайн Юрий

  • Старожил
  • ****
  • Сообщений: 322
    • Просмотр профиля
    • Во-Сток
Re: Отображаются отключенные элементы
« Ответ #4 : Ноября 13, 2011, 01:38:39 am »
Ну страницы их убираются. Но в дереве каталога - остаются....

nictboom

  • Гость
Re: Отображаются отключенные элементы
« Ответ #5 : Ноября 13, 2011, 02:01:54 am »
всё в том же cfg/category_functions.php в function All_Categories, заменить
   $q db_query("SELECT categoryID, name, products_count, products_count_admin, parent, enabled, hurl FROM ".CATEGORIES_TABLE.' WHERE categoryID<>0 and parent='.$parent.' ORDER BY '.CONF_SORT_CATEGORY." ".CONF_SORT_CATEGORY_BY);
на   $q db_query("SELECT categoryID, name, products_count, products_count_admin, parent, enabled, hurl FROM ".CATEGORIES_TABLE.' WHERE categoryID<>0 and parent='.$parent.' and enabled=1 ORDER BY '.CONF_SORT_CATEGORY." ".CONF_SORT_CATEGORY_BY);